How is an editorial different from a news story?

The main contrast lies in their purpose. News stories are intended to inform the public about events as they happened. Editorials, though, are used to influence public opinion or spark discussion. Another difference is the style - news is more straightforward, while editorials can be more elaborate and argumentative.

An editorial expresses an opinion or viewpoint, while a news story aims to present facts objectively. Editorials are often more subjective and persuasive.

How is a feature story different from a news story?

Well, a major difference is that feature stories offer a more comprehensive look. They might explore a topic over a longer period or include personal experiences. News stories, on the other hand, are immediate and to the point, giving the key facts right away.

How is an opinion piece different from a news story?

The main difference is that an opinion piece allows for subjective commentary and analysis. A news story, on the other hand, is focused on reporting events and information as accurately as possible, without the author's personal opinions influencing the content.
